The association between female adolescents in high school who use illicit drugs & seriously consider attempting suicide was examined. Data were analyzed from the 2003 Youth Risk Behavioral Surveillance System. Variables for suicidal thoughts, illicit drugs, & covariables were chosen to explore the association. Seriously considering attempting suicide was associated with Hispanics, suburban youth, use of marijuana, inhalants, methamphetamines, & steroids without a doctor’s prescription. Greater effort may be necessary to raise awareness about the physical & mental health status of Hispanic adolescents & to ensure good mental health programs are available. (28 refs.) JA
